AI & Data Intelligence: a strategic project for the operational future of SCI Value


A few weeks ago, we initiated an internal research and development project to explore the potential of artificial intelligence in optimising production processes and enhancing data value. The goal is clear: to understand how this technology can improve operational efficiency, safeguarding the company’s vast informational assets and making them even more accessible.

In a sector where data quality is essential for analysis and strategic decisions, introducing advanced technologies is a necessary evolution to strengthen an already well-established working method.

We aim to integrate artificial intelligence into internal processes, with the goal of improving efficiency and the capacity to interpret data.

Engineer Sesto, CEO of SCI VALUE, explains how the company, always orientated towards maintaining a competitive advantage by using advanced tools and market foresight, is launching an internal project dedicated to artificial intelligence: ‘The aim is to explore the potential of this technology to strengthen our productive capacity while preserving the integrity and value of the informational assets upon which our system is based.’

The proprietary database includes over 500,000 suppliers coded according to geographic homogeneity criteria and classified by type (industry, wholesaler, retailer) across all of Italy. It is connected to around 30 million prices and  represents one of the main strategic assets of the company. Thanks to the adoption of AI solutions, this data will be even more accessible, readable and functional, especially for the analysis and production team.

How artificial intelligence will enhance processes and improve service quality

The integration of artificial intelligence into operational flows represents a strategic evolution for SCI Value. In particular, AI will significantly impact two key areas: the improvement of Reverse Value Engineering® and the strengthening of Project Management and Project Monitoring activities.

1. Reverse Value Engineering®:
The adoption of AI systems in the proprietary RVE® process opens up new possibilities for analysis and optimisation.

  • Intelligent comparative analysis: artificial intelligence is capable of exploring the entire database of materials, technologies and construction solutions, assessing according to multiple criteria, including cost, performance, sustainability and availability. This allows for the identification of more efficient alternatives, improving the cost-benefit ratio for every project.
  • Simulations and design optimisation: thanks to the use of predictive models and advanced simulation tools, it becomes possible to virtually test different design solutions before physically implementing them, reducing error margins and decision times. This approach allows for quick and objective comparison of available alternatives, identifying the most efficient options.
  • Forecasting costs and times: The integration between historical data analysis and market dynamics reading allows AI to develop more reliable cost and time estimates, making the tendering phase more precise and strategic. This approach also contributes to a more targeted and efficient supplier selection, improving the overall planning quality.

2. Project Management and Project Monitoring:
In coordinating assignments, artificial intelligence offers planning and monitoring tools that increase responsiveness and overall vision.

  • Intelligent planning: advanced algorithms allow for the optimisation of activity sequences, resource distribution and management of critical issues. In the event of unforeseen circumstances, AI can reformulate the operational plan in real time, minimising delays and costs.
  • Predictive monitoring: by continuously analysing advancement data, artificial intelligence can identify potential deviations from the planned schedule in advance, allowing action to be taken before they become operational issues.
  • Documentation management: AI allows for the organisation and easy consultation of all project information, from technical drawings to communications, ensuring immediate access to data and operational continuity even in future projects.

The effectiveness of artificial intelligence depends on the quality of the data and the ability to use it consciously. SCI Value starts from a solid and well-structured database, which will be further enhanced through investments in technology and staff training. 

The integration of AI will begin with a focused pilot project, useful for testing solutions and evaluating benefits before a wider rollout. At the same time, support from technological partners with experience in real estate will be essential to accelerate the process and fully maximise results.

Artificial intelligence does not replace the SCI Value method – it enhances it. This tool allows us to work in a more precise manner, anticipate issues and offer even more targeted services.
